Cimitero:MediaWiki:Common.js: differenze tra le versioni

m
Wedhro ha spostato la pagina MediaWiki:Common.js a Cimitero:MediaWiki:Common.js senza lasciare redirect: è talmente pieno di cose che non funzionano o del tutto obsolete che faccio prima a ripartire da 0
(Prova)
m (Wedhro ha spostato la pagina MediaWiki:Common.js a Cimitero:MediaWiki:Common.js senza lasciare redirect: è talmente pieno di cose che non funzionano o del tutto obsolete che faccio prima a ripartire da 0)
 
(26 versioni intermedie di 7 utenti non mostrate)
Riga 14:
var fadeDelay = 400;
var navigationBarShowDefault = 0; // Usato per cassetto
 
importArticles({
type: 'script',
articles: [
// AbuseFilter in RC
'MediaWiki:Common.js/afTable.js',
// Test Generator
'MediaWiki:Common.js/TestGen.js',
// Patch varie
'MediaWiki:Common.js/Patch.js',
// Funzionalità importanti
'MediaWiki:Common.js/Importanti.js',
// Ritocchi vari
'MediaWiki:Common.js/Varie.js',
// Logo Random
'MediaWiki:Common.js/RandomLogo.js',
// Morph
'MediaWiki:Common.js/Morph.js',
]
});
 
importArticle({
type: "style",
article: "MediaWiki:Common.css/Infobox.css"
});
 
// END Importazioni
 
//Riporterò tutto a posto quando avrò finito.
 
 
/*************** Variabili di regolazione degli effetti ***************/
Line 49 ⟶ 19:
var disableTargetBlank = false; // Disabilita la funzione targetBlank()
var disableUsernameReplace = false; // Disabilita la funzione usernameReplace()
// var disableAlert = false; // Disabilita le funzioni alertLink() e alertLoad()
var disableRefTooltip = false; // Disabilita la funzione refTooltip()
var buttonPurge = false; // Abilita la funzione createPurgeButton()
Line 68 ⟶ 38:
 
/*************** Caricamento della pagina ***************/
$mw.hook(document)'nonciclopedia.ready').add(function() {
// Funzione che stabilisce quando una pagina si è caricata (sostituisce addOnloadHook, che si avvia troppo tardi)
$(document).ready(function() {
if(skin == 'wikiamobile') {
setTimeout('hooksMobile();', 800);
}
else {
setTimeout('hooksCommon();', 800);
}
return;
});
 
// Funzioni da avviare unicamente al caricamento della pagina
function hooksCommon() {
// Patch
uncyPtPatch();
Line 94 ⟶ 52:
if(wgPageName == 'Speciale:Entra') registrationPatch();
if(wgPageName == 'Speciale:AdminDashboard') dashboardPatch();
oasisCheck()
if(wgPageName == 'Speciale:Forum')
 
if(document.URL.indexOf("'useskin=oasis") >= 0){
if(document.URL.indexOf("Speciale:Forum") >= 0){
forumPatch();
else if(document.URL.indexOf("Conversazione:") >= 0){
forumPatch();
return;
}
return;
}
return;
}
 
// Skin
startAjaxWatch();
hidingToolBox();
toolbarCookieHide();
linkAdQ();
if(wgUserName) dismissableNotice();
if(wgAction == 'edit' || wgAction == 'submit') quickEditor();
if(buttonPurge && wgCanonicalNamespace != 'Special') createPurgeButton();
Line 119 ⟶ 63:
// Inclusioni
// Sintassi: importScript(script, condizione);
importScript('NonciclopediaMediaWiki:Script/Pesce_aprile_2009.js', wgPageName == 'Nonciclopedia:Storia/Pagine_commemorative/Pesci_d\'aprile/3');
importScript('Nonciclopedia:Script/MD5.js', true);
importScript('NonciclopediaMediaWiki:Script/Pesce_aprile_2010.js', wgPageName == 'Nonciclopedia:Storia/Pagine_commemorative/Pesci_d\'aprile/4');
importScript('Nonciclopedia:Script/flipCounter.js', true);
importScript('NonciclopediaMediaWiki:Script/SlotMachinePesce_aprile_2011.js', wgPageName == 'GiochiNonciclopedia:CasiNonciStoria/Pagine_commemorative/Pesci_d\'aprile/Slot_machine5');
importScript('Nonciclopedia:Script/Pesce_aprile_2009.js', wgPageName == 'Nonciclopedia:Storia/Pagine_commemorative/Pesci_d\'aprile/3');
importScript('Nonciclopedia:Script/Pesce_aprile_2010.js', wgPageName == 'Nonciclopedia:Storia/Pagine_commemorative/Pesci_d\'aprile/4');
importScript('Nonciclopedia:Script/Pesce_aprile_2011.js', wgPageName == 'Nonciclopedia:Storia/Pagine_commemorative/Pesci_d\'aprile/5');
//Funzioni dell'anteprima
Line 142 ⟶ 83:
}
}
});
return;
}
 
// Funzioni da avviare al caricamento della pagina e dell'anteprima
Line 169 ⟶ 109:
if(!disableTargetBlank) targetBlank();
if(!disableUsernameReplace) usernameReplace();
if(!disableAlert) {
alertLink();
setTimeout(alertLoad, 1);
}
if(!disableRefTooltip) refTooltip();
if(!navBarDebug) createNavigationBarToggleButton();
Line 286 ⟶ 222:
if(skin != 'wikiamobile' && mwCustomEditButtons) {
mwCustomEditButtons[mwCustomEditButtons.length] = {
"imageFile": "httphttps://upload.wikimedia.org/wikipedia/commons/0/0c/Button_P_template.png",
"speedTip": "Template",
"tagOpen": "{{",
Line 293 ⟶ 229:
};
mwCustomEditButtons[mwCustomEditButtons.length] = {
"imageFile": "httphttps://upload.wikimedia.org/wikipedia/commons/0/05/Button_Anf%C3%BChrung.png",
"speedTip": "Citazione",
"tagOpen": "{{Cit2|",
Line 303 ⟶ 239:
// Pulsanti da aggiungere nella pagina di modifica: sistema di aggiornamento centralizzato
var pulsanteAccusa = {
'imageFile': 'httphttps://imagesstatic.wikiamiraheze.comorg/nonciclopedia/imagesnonciclopediawiki/9/93/Button_Jessica.png',
'speedTip': 'Articolo in dubbio',
'tagOpen': '{{Accusa|accusa=',
'tagClose': '|firma=--~~' + '~~}' + '}\n\n',
'sampleText': 'Inserire qui l\'accusa'
};
 
var pulsanteAllinea = {
'imageFile': 'httphttps://images1static.wikiamiraheze.nocookie.net/__cb20100806112819/nonciclopediaorg/imagesnonciclopediawiki/f/f7/Button_align_center.png',
'speedTip': 'Centrato',
'tagOpen': '{{Allinea|center|',
Line 319 ⟶ 255:
 
var pulsanteAllineaDX = {
"imageFile": "httphttps://images4upload.wikiawikimedia.nocookie.net/__cb20100806112820org/nonciclopediawikipedia/imagescommons/ea/eaa5/Button_align_right.png",
"speedTip": "Align right",
"tagOpen": '{{Allinea|right|',
Line 327 ⟶ 263:
 
var pulsanteAllineaSX = {
"imageFile": "httphttps://images4upload.wikiawikimedia.nocookie.net/__cb20100806112820org/nonciclopediawikipedia/imagescommons/e/ea/Button_align_left.png",
"speedTip": "Align left",
"tagOpen": '{{Allinea|left|',
Line 343 ⟶ 279:
 
var pulsanteAPU = {
'imageFile': 'httphttps://imagesstatic.wikiamiraheze.comorg/nonciclopedia/imagesnonciclopediawiki/0/0a/Button_sad.png',
'speedTip': 'Articolo poco umoristico',
'tagOpen': '{{Accusa|accusa=APU|firma=--~~' + '~~}' + '}\n\n',
'tagClose': '',
'sampleText': ''
Line 351 ⟶ 287:
 
var pulsanteBarrato = {
'imageFile': 'httphttps://upload.wikimedia.org/wikipedia/en/c/c9/Button_strike.png',
'speedTip': 'Barrato',
'tagOpen': '{{s|',
Line 359 ⟶ 295:
 
var pulsanteBig = {
'imageFile': 'httphttps://images.wikia.comnocookie.net/nonciclopedia/images/5/56/Button_big.png',
'speedTip': 'Grande',
'tagOpen': '{{Dimensione|125%|',
Line 367 ⟶ 303:
 
var pulsanteBTA = {
'imageFile': 'httphttps://images.wikia.comnocookie.net/nonciclopedia/images/3/34/Button_MrX.png',
'speedTip': 'Battute tra amici',
'tagOpen': '{{Cancellazione|motivo=BTA|firma=--~~' + '~~}' + '}\n\n',
'tagClose': '',
'sampleText': ''
Line 375 ⟶ 311:
 
var pulsanteCancellazione = {
'imageFile': 'httphttps://images.wikia.comnocookie.net/nonciclopedia/images/0/0c/Button_Chuck.png',
'speedTip': 'Cancellazione immediata (USARE CON CAUTELA!)',
'tagOpen': '{{Cancellazione|motivo=',
'tagClose': '|firma=--~~' + '~~}' + '}\n\n',
'sampleText': 'Inserire qui il motivo'
};
 
var pulsanteCarattere = {
'imageFile': 'httphttps://images3images.wikia.nocookie.net/nonciclopedia/images/8/8c/Bottone_Carattere.png',
'speedTip': 'Carattere',
'tagOpen': '{{Carattere|Tipo di carattere|dim%|',
Line 391 ⟶ 327:
 
var pulsanteCassetto = {
'imageFile': 'httphttps://images2images.wikia.nocookie.net/nonciclopedia/images/3/38/Button_cassetto.png',
'speedTip': 'Cassetto',
'tagOpen': '{{Cassetto|titolo=Titolo cassetto|testo=',
Line 407 ⟶ 343:
 
var pulsanteCC = {
'imageFile': 'httphttps://images2images.wikia.nocookie.net/nonciclopedia/images/0/04/Button_Creative_Commons.png',
'speedTip': 'Creative Commons',
'tagOpen': '{{Creative Commons|by=y|nc=y|sa=y|versione=3.0}' + '}\n',
Line 415 ⟶ 351:
 
var pulsanteCensura = {
'imageFile': 'httphttps://images4images.wikia.nocookie.net/nonciclopedia/images/2/20/Button_censura2.png',
'speedTip': 'Censura',
'tagOpen': '{{Censura|',
Line 423 ⟶ 359:
 
var pulsanteCit2 = {
'imageFile': 'httphttps://images4images.wikia.nocookie.net/nonciclopedia/images/6/6f/Button_cit2.png',
'speedTip': 'Citazione 2',
'tagOpen': '{{Cit2|',
Line 431 ⟶ 367:
 
var pulsanteCitnec = {
'imageFile': 'httphttps://images1images.wikia.nocookie.net/nonciclopedia/images/f/f6/Button_Citnec.png',
'speedTip': 'Citazione necessaria',
'tagOpen': '{{Citnec|',
Line 439 ⟶ 375:
 
var pulsanteColonne = {
'imageFile': 'httphttps://images3images.wikia.nocookie.net/__cb20100806112827/nonciclopedia/images/1/15/Button_colonne.png',
'speedTip': 'Testo in colonne',
'tagOpen': '{{Colonne|col=2|',
Line 447 ⟶ 383:
 
var pulsanteColore = {
'imageFile': 'httphttps://images1images.wikia.nocookie.net/nonciclopedia/images/0/0f/Bottone_colore.png',
'speedTip': 'Colore',
'tagOpen': '{{Colore|#Codice esadecimale|',
Line 455 ⟶ 391:
 
var pulsanteDimensione = {
'imageFile': 'httphttps://images2images.wikia.nocookie.net/nonciclopedia/images/2/2f/Bottone_dimensione.png',
'speedTip': 'Dimensione',
'tagOpen': '{{Dimensione|dim%|',
Line 463 ⟶ 399:
 
var pulsanteFormattazione1 = {
'imageFile': 'httphttps://images.wikia.comnocookie.net/nonciclopedia/images/d/d6/E%27fiamme.png',
'speedTip': 'Formattazione',
'tagOpen': '{{Formattazione|note=',
'tagClose': '|firma=--~~' + '~~}' + '}\n\n',
'sampleText': 'Inserire qui cosa fare'
};
 
var pulsanteFormattazione2 = {
'imageFile': 'httphttps://images.wikia.comnocookie.net/nonciclopedia/images/e/e1/E%27mat.png',
'speedTip': 'Formattazione',
'tagOpen': '{{Formattazione|note=',
'tagClose': '|firma=--~~' + '~~}' + '}\n\n',
'sampleText': 'Inserire qui cosa fare'
};
 
var pulsanteGallery = {
'imageFile': 'httphttps://images.wikia.comnocookie.net/central/images/1/12/Button_gallery.png',
'speedTip': 'Galleria di immagini',
'tagOpen': '\n<gallery>\n',
Line 487 ⟶ 423:
 
var pulsanteManuali = {
'imageFile': 'httphttps://images.wikia.comnocookie.net/nonciclopedia/images/f/fe/Bottone_Man.png',
'speedTip': 'Link ai manuali',
'tagOpen': '{{Man|',
Line 495 ⟶ 431:
 
var pulsanteNomedimmerda = {
'imageFile': 'httphttps://images4images.wikia.nocookie.net/nonciclopedia/images/3/33/Sguardone.png',
'speedTip': 'Immagine da rinominare ',
'tagOpen': '{{Nomedimmerda|scadenza={{subst:7g}' + '}|motivo=',
'tagClose': '|firma=--~~' + '~~}' + '}\n\n',
'sampleText': 'Inserisci un suggerimento'
};
Line 511 ⟶ 447:
 
var pulsanteRedirect = {
'imageFile': 'httphttps://images2images.wikia.nocookie.net/nonciclopedia/images/7/73/Bottone_redirect.png',
'speedTip': 'Redirect',
'tagOpen': '#REDIRECT [[',
Line 519 ⟶ 455:
 
var pulsanteReflink = {
'imageFile': 'httphttps://images4images.wikia.nocookie.net/nonciclopedia/images/6/6e/Bottone_reflink.png',
'speedTip': 'Inserisci la nota nel testo',
'tagOpen': '<ref>',
Line 527 ⟶ 463:
 
var pulsanteRestauro = {
'imageFile': 'httphttps://images3images.wikia.nocookie.net/nonciclopedia/images/6/6c/Button_restauro.png',
'speedTip': 'Articolo da sistemare',
'tagOpen': '{{Restauro|motivo=',
'tagClose': '|firma=--~~' + '~~}' + '}\n\n',
'sampleText': 'Inserire qui la descrizione'
};
 
var pulsanteRiquadro1 = {
'imageFile': 'httphttps://images.wikia.comnocookie.net/nonciclopedia/images/f/f9/Button_box.png',
'speedTip': 'Box',
'tagOpen': '{{Riquadro\n|larghezza=\n|colore-sfondo=\n|colore-testo=\n|colore-bordo=\n|spessore-bordo=\n|testo=\n|file-sx=\n|largh-file-sx=\n|file-dx=\n|largh-file-dx=\n}' + '}\n',
Line 543 ⟶ 479:
 
var pulsanteRiquadro2 = {
'imageFile': 'httphttps://images.wikia.comnocookie.net/nonciclopedia/images/f/f9/Button_box.png',
'speedTip': 'Box',
'tagOpen': '{{Riquadro\n|classe=\n|larghezza=\n|colore-sfondo=\n|colore-testo=\n|colore-bordo=\n|stile-bordo=\n|spessore-bordo=\n|stile-riquadro=\n|testo=\n|file-sx=\n|largh-file-sx=\n|file-dx=\n|largh-file-dx=\n}' + '}\n',
Line 551 ⟶ 487:
 
var pulsanteScadenza = {
'imageFile': 'httphttps://images.wikia.comnocookie.net/nonciclopedia/images/a/a5/Button_Samara.png',
'speedTip': 'Articolo in scadenza',
'tagOpen': '{{Scadenza|scadenza=' + '{{subst:7g}' + '}|note=',
'tagClose': '|firma=--~~' + '~~}' + '}\n\n',
'sampleText': 'Note'
};
 
var pulsanteSmall = {
'imageFile': 'httphttps://images.wikia.comnocookie.net/nonciclopedia/images/5/58/Button_small.png',
'speedTip': 'Piccolo',
'tagOpen': '{{Dimensione|80%|',
Line 567 ⟶ 503:
 
var pulsanteSottolineato = {
'imageFile': 'httphttps://images4images.wikia.nocookie.net/nonciclopedia/images/f/fd/Button_underline.png',
'speedTip': 'Sottolineato',
'tagOpen': '{{u|',
Line 575 ⟶ 511:
 
var pulsanteTabella = {
'imageFile': 'httphttps://upload.wikimedia.org/wikipedia/en/6/60/Button_insert_table.png',
'speedTip': 'Tabella',
'tagOpen': '{| class="wikitable"\n|-\n',
Line 583 ⟶ 519:
 
var pulsanteVideo = {
'imageFile': 'httphttps://images2images.wikia.nocookie.net/__cb20100915172123/nonciclopedia/images/f/ff/Bottone_video.png',
'speedTip': 'Inserisci un video - Per i parametri aggiuntivi leggi la pagina del template',
'tagOpen': '{{YoutubeVideo|',
Line 591 ⟶ 527:
 
var pulsanteEvidenzia = {
"imageFile": "httphttps://img2images.wikia.nocookie.net/__cb20140408123004/nonciclopedia/images/b/b5/Bottone_evidenziatore.png",
"speedTip": "Evidenziatore",
"tagOpen": "{{Evidenzia|giallo|",